Sustainable Waterloo has an event on January 27th as a follow up on the internationally over hyped, much anticipated COP15 Conference. Here's the deal:

"As the goals and potential outcomes of the much anticipated 15th UN Climate Change Conference (COP15) in Copenhagen continue to shift daily, the only certainty seems that the impacts on future GHG reductions will be complex. How will Copenhagen affect regional and national carbon regulation? What will the consequences be on businesses and Waterloo Region specifically?

As a follow up to the international negotiations in Copenhagen this month, our January Educational Forum aims to provide attendees with answers to these questions and more, and features a panel of experts currently at the conference."
